A woman and her grandson were killed when an under-construction building collapsed in west Delhi while they were on way to a market, police said today.

The three-storeyed building collapsed in Guru Nanak Dev Nagar locality in west Delhi last evening in which three persons were also injured and police have arrested the contractor Harpreet Singh.

Kamal Devi and her grandson Akshit, 3, were killed in the incident. "They were on way to market to buy milk when the building came down crashing. Parts of concrete fell on them and they died," a senior police official said.

Police said they were yet to ascertain the cause of the collapse. A case has been registered and further investigations are on, the official said.Police said construction activity was going on at the building to add more floors when it came crashing down at around 5pm yesterday.

Some passers-by were trapped under the debris and a Maruti van was damaged, the official said adding a case of negligence was registered.

Soon after the incident, four fire tenders were rushed to the spot and firemen pulled out four persons, including three children from the debris.

All of them were rushed to Maharaja Agrasen Hospital where the woman Kamal Devi and her grandson succumbed to their injuries.
